메뉴 건너뛰기




Volumn 2805, Issue , 2003, Pages 94-113

Adaptable translator of B specifications to embedded C programs

Author keywords

B method; Code generation; Embedded systems; Smart cards

Indexed keywords

CODES (SYMBOLS); COMPUTATIONAL LINGUISTICS; EMBEDDED SYSTEMS; FORMAL METHODS; JAVA PROGRAMMING LANGUAGE; PROGRAM TRANSLATORS; SMART CARDS; TRANSLATION (LANGUAGES); TRANSPORTATION;

EID: 35248816457     PISSN: 03029743     EISSN: 16113349     Source Type: Book Series    
DOI: 10.1007/978-3-540-45236-2_7     Document Type: Article
Times cited : (38)

References (20)
  • 2
    • 84958060420 scopus 로고    scopus 로고
    • Météor: A Successful Application of B in a Large Project
    • FM'99 - Formal Methods, Springer-Verlag
    • P. Behm, P. Benoit, A. Faivre, and J.-M. Meynadier. Météor: A Successful Application of B in a Large Project. In FM'99 - Formal Methods, pages 369-388. LNCS 1708, Springer-Verlag, 1999.
    • (1999) LNCS , vol.1708 , pp. 369-388
    • Behm, P.1    Benoit, P.2    Faivre, A.3    Meynadier, J.-M.4
  • 3
    • 84949204326 scopus 로고    scopus 로고
    • Well Defined B
    • D. Bert, editor, B '98: Recent Advances in the Development and Use of the B Method. Springer-Verlag
    • P. Behm, L. Burdy, and J-M Meynadier. Well Defined B. In D. Bert, editor, B '98: Recent Advances in the Development and Use of the B Method. LNCS 1393, Springer-Verlag, 1998.
    • (1998) LNCS , vol.1393
    • Behm, P.1    Burdy, L.2    Meynadier, J.-M.3
  • 6
    • 84937428334 scopus 로고    scopus 로고
    • Development of an Embedded Verifier for Java Card Byte Code using Formal Methods
    • L.-H. Eriksson and P. A. Lindsay, editors, Formal Methods Europe (FME), Copenhagen, Springer-Verlag
    • L. Casset. Development of an Embedded Verifier for Java Card Byte Code using Formal Methods. In L.-H. Eriksson and P. A. Lindsay, editors, Formal Methods Europe (FME), pages 290-309, Copenhagen, 2002. LNCS 2391, Springer-Verlag.
    • (2002) LNCS , vol.2391 , pp. 290-309
    • Casset, L.1
  • 7
    • 0036928460 scopus 로고    scopus 로고
    • Formal Development of an embedded verifier for Java Card Byte Code
    • Washington, D.C., USA, June IEEE Computer Society
    • L. Casset, L. Burdy, and A. Requet. Formal Development of an embedded verifier for Java Card Byte Code. In International Conference on Dependable Systems & Networks (DSN), pages 51-58, Washington, D.C., USA, June 2002. IEEE Computer Society.
    • (2002) International Conference on Dependable Systems & Networks (DSN) , pp. 51-58
    • Casset, L.1    Burdy, L.2    Requet, A.3
  • 9
    • 35248856039 scopus 로고    scopus 로고
    • ClearSy. Technical report, ClearSy System Engineering
    • ClearSy. B Language Reference Manual, version 1.8.5. Technical report, ClearSy System Engineering, URL :http://www.clearsy.com/, 2001.
    • (2001) B Language Reference Manual, Version 1.8.5
  • 10
    • 84954408551 scopus 로고    scopus 로고
    • Formal Proof of Smart Card Applets Correctness
    • J.-J. Quisquater and B. Schneier, editors, CARDIS, Springer-Verlag
    • J.-L. Lanet and A. Requet. Formal Proof of Smart Card Applets Correctness. In J.-J. Quisquater and B. Schneier, editors, CARDIS, pages 85-97. LNCS 1820, Springer-Verlag, 2000.
    • (2000) LNCS , vol.1820 , pp. 85-97
    • Lanet, J.-L.1    Requet, A.2
  • 13
    • 35248833133 scopus 로고    scopus 로고
    • Using Formal and Semi-Formal Methods for a Common Criteria Evaluation
    • Marseille, France
    • S. Motré and C. Téri. Using Formal and Semi-Formal Methods for a Common Criteria Evaluation. In EUROSMART, Marseille, France, 2000.
    • (2000) EUROSMART
    • Motré, S.1    Téri, C.2
  • 14
    • 84878596491 scopus 로고    scopus 로고
    • Translation Validation for Synchronous Languages
    • K. G. Larsen, S. Skyum, and G. Winskel, editors, Proc. of the 25th Int. Colloquium on Automata, Languages and Programming (ICALP 1998), Springer-Verlag
    • A. Pnueli, M. Siegel, and O. Shtrichman. Translation Validation for Synchronous Languages. In K. G. Larsen, S. Skyum, and G. Winskel, editors, Proc. of the 25th Int. Colloquium on Automata, Languages and Programming (ICALP 1998), pages 235-246. LNCS 1443, Springer-Verlag, 1998.
    • (1998) LNCS , vol.1443 , pp. 235-246
    • Pnueli, A.1    Siegel, M.2    Shtrichman, O.3
  • 16
    • 84949208050 scopus 로고    scopus 로고
    • Composition and Refinement in the B method
    • D. Bert, editor, B'98 : Recent Advances in the Development and Use of the B Method, Springer-Verlag
    • M.-L. Potet and Y. Rouzaud. Composition and Refinement in the B method. In D. Bert, editor, B'98 : Recent Advances in the Development and Use of the B Method, pages 46-65. LNCS 1393, Springer-Verlag, 1998.
    • (1998) LNCS , vol.1393 , pp. 46-65
    • Potet, M.-L.1    Rouzaud, Y.2
  • 17
    • 0037332751 scopus 로고    scopus 로고
    • A B Model for Ensuring Soundness of the Java Card Virtual Machine
    • Extended Version.
    • A. Requet. A B Model for Ensuring Soundness of the Java Card Virtual Machine (Extended Version). Science of Computer Programming, Elsevier Science, 46(3):283-306, 2003.
    • (2003) Science of Computer Programming, Elsevier Science , vol.46 , Issue.3 , pp. 283-306
    • Requet, A.1
  • 19
    • 0004301215 scopus 로고    scopus 로고
    • International Standard. ISO/IEC 9899:1999 (E)
    • International Standard. Programming languages - C. ISO/IEC 9899:1999 (E).
    • Programming Languages - C


* 이 정보는 Elsevier사의 SCOPUS DB에서 KISTI가 분석하여 추출한 것입니다.